Please help keep Fenway Bark's guests healthy!



To keep the guests in our care as healthy and safe as possible, we thoughtfully request that if your dog has been diagnosed with a flea infestation, intestinal parasites or communicable bacterial or viral infection, that you remedy the situation before bringing your dog back into our daycare or boarding environment.  Let us know when you need to cancel standing reservations because of illness.

If your dog has been diagnosed with an intestinal parasite (e.g., giardia, hookworm, roundworm, tapeworm), please seek treatment through your veterinarian and have your dog retested via a fecal exam before returning to our care.  We will need to receive a copy of the negative fecal test results upon your dog's return.  Some intestinal parasites are easily transferred to both dogs and humans and it is very important that we keep both as healthy as possible.

Likewise, it is important for you to communicate to us any injuries, sore spots, or other we need to be mindful of for the comfort of your pet. 

As warmer weather allows for more time outdoor time, it also provides the possibility of exposure to ticks, fleas, and other hazards.  Please keep your dog from drinking standing water to reduce the possibility of leptospirosis and also re-direct your dog from other dog's waste that may contain communicable parasites.

Thank you so much for helping us by doing your part to keep every guest safe while in both our and your care.

Our One Year Anniversary


It is hard to believe that we are at our one year anniversary of opening our daycare and boarding business!

Opening a small business is not for the faint of heart and opening one in a down economy with a fresh approach to an established industry may have made us certifiably loco.  That said, the business model, our approach and Fenway Bark's services have clearly resonated with pet families throughout New England.  We continue to grow through the kind recommendations of you, our satisfied customers.

Thank you!

In the first year, Fenway Bark:

- has served more than 1200 four legged customers
- has provided services for customers stretching from California to Florida to many of our closest neighbors who live just a block or two away or work in the same building
- was recognized as one of the top daycare facilities in the United States by Fido Friendly magazine in July 2011, and one of the top 50 dog destinations in the World
- appeared on Chronicle, Fox TV, and Dr. Jake's segment on NECN
- was featured in Stuff, London Times, Boston Globe, and more
- helped place over a dozen homeless dogs for Great Dog Rescue of New England
- created 14 jobs in the South Boston market
- welcomed The Pawsitive Dog, Dawgma Gallery, and Zen Animal Massage into the Fenway Bark to enhance our portfolio of services

And although we faced some difficult challenges in the first year, many of which felt like they were played out in, well, dog years, it was the customers who embraced the business so strongly, our family and friends, and our talented employee team that was the wind under our wings to keep us going, even through the most difficult times.  No doubt the joy of caring for your wonderful pets also fueled our resolve.
